Leveraging AI for Personalized Learning Paths

Artificial intelligence is revolutionizing the educational technology landscape by enabling unprecedented levels of personalization. Traditional classroom settings often struggle to cater to the diverse learning speeds and styles of students. AI-powered edtech platforms can analyze individual student performance, identify specific areas of difficulty, and adapt the learning material in real-time. This means that a student struggling with a particular mathematical concept can receive targeted explanations and additional practice problems, while another student who grasps the concept quickly can move on to more advanced topics, ensuring no one is left behind and everyone is challenged appropriately. The integrity of math education is bolstered by AI’s ability to provide immediate, constructive feedback. When students work through problems, AI can pinpoint errors, explain the reasoning behind the correct solution, and offer alternative approaches. This instant feedback loop is crucial for reinforcing learning and preventing the solidification of misunderstandings, which can lead to significant knowledge gaps over time. The Role of Edtech in Bridging Educational Divides

Educational technology, or edtech, plays a pivotal role in democratizing access to quality learning resources. For students in underserved communities or those with limited access to traditional tutoring, edtech platforms can provide a wealth of educational content and interactive learning experiences. AI-driven tools within these platforms can further enhance accessibility by offering features like automated translation, text-to-speech, and simplified explanations, thereby breaking down barriers to understanding, especially in subjects like mathematics where conceptual clarity is paramount.

Furthermore, edtech solutions can help to standardize the quality of instruction, ensuring that all students, regardless of their geographical location or socioeconomic background, have the opportunity to learn from well-structured curricula.
